### EXIF Scrubber — Release Signing

Once the MetaWipe test matrix is green, freeze the branch and bump the version in the manifest. Build the scrubber binary for all three targets and confirm each one strips GPS, serial, and timestamp tags from the fixture set. Do not publish until every artifact carries a valid signature. The release manager signs each artifact using the key printed below.

deploy key for kajof-fajop: bky6_gDHw9Q

## Releases

Hey support folks — quick notes on ProfileMesh shard releases. Each release re-balances user-profile shards gradually, so don't panic if a lookup lands on a stale shard for a few minutes post-deploy; it self-heals. Release bundles are published twice a month and are always signed. If a customer asks you to verify a bundle they downloaded, walk them through the checksum step using the public signing key below.

deploy key for kawif-bageg: bky19_YQNdHDgpaLxUNwPoHm9

# Read-replica lag alarm for the Mossbeck reporting tier.
#
# Fires when replication lag exceeds the warning threshold for a full
# evaluation window; pages only past the critical bound. Don't tune these
# without checking the nightly batch schedule — lag spikes then are
# expected. Current thresholds follow.

tuning constants:
QUOTAS = {
    "druwyn": 5,
    "holix": 5,
    "zorath": 5,
    "holwyn": 10,
}

## Deployment — Brinewell Sweeper

The Brinewell retention sweeper deploys as a single container, one instance per region. It scans expired records nightly and hard-deletes after the grace window. Deploy via the standard pipeline; no manual steps. Dry-run mode is on by default in staging. Review the following configuration before approving a production rollout.

deployment values, yafop-tahof:
HOLIX_HOST=holix.zemvarsys.internal
HOLIX_PORT=3306

## Step 4: Cut over the billing worker

Ledgerbee now runs blue-green for the billing worker. Plugin authors must stop pinning the worker hostname; resolve via the router instead. Drain the green pool, verify invoice checkpoints match, then flip traffic. Rollback is a single flag revert — do not redeploy. Before flipping, confirm your plugin reads the live values below.

config for kagup-hahig:
druwyn:
  pin: 2801
  metrics_host: metrics.druwyn.zemvarlabs.internal
  tenant: sorius
  seal: seal_798a43d7